Are Wall Street Analysts Predicting Builders FirstSource Stock Will Climb or Sink?

Builders FirstSource, Inc. (BLDR), a major supplier of building materials based in Irving, Texas, is facing a challenging outlook as Wall Street analysts issue mixed predictions for its stock. Over the past year, BLDR shares have dropped 49.1%, significantly underperforming the broader S&P 500 Index, which has seen a near 20.6% increase. The company, which has a market cap of $7.8 billion and operates around 570 distribution and manufacturing locations across 43 states, is struggling to regain momentum in a tough housing market.

The current difficulties stem from a combination of high interest rates and housing affordability issues that have dampened demand for new residential construction. Builders FirstSource has reported a decline in both single-family and multi-family housing starts, which has negatively impacted its sales volumes. Additionally, shifts in market trends toward smaller, more affordable homes have led to lower pricing power and gross margin compression. This has contributed to a disappointing earnings season, with BLDR's second-quarter results missing Wall Street's expectations for both earnings per share and revenue.

For the current fiscal year, analysts predict a significant drop in BLDR's earnings, forecasting a 54.3% decline to $3.15 per diluted share. The company's history of earnings surprises has also been underwhelming, with three misses in the last four quarters. Of the 25 analysts covering the stock, there is a consensus rating of "Moderate Buy," which reflects a more cautious stance than previously noted, as one analyst recently downgraded their rating to "Strong Sell."

Looking ahead, Builders FirstSource anticipates full-year revenue between $14 billion and $14.8 billion. The companyโ€™s ability to navigate the ongoing challenges in the housing market will be crucial for its recovery. Investors will be closely watching for signs of improvement in demand and margins, as well as any shifts in analystsโ€™ sentiment as the fiscal year progresses.
